Output 896d9ec0a57ea13f3ba93ed8fd1bff743f024db9f7abc97d7c942a6ec00f639f:0

value
21304680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d785a01b0d434e3f91535fe7938ec8aff0cb76b3 OP_EQUAL
address
3MLbHF6CWRxTgEZ97bE4XefKVJr51EaCYv
transaction
896d9ec0a57ea13f3ba93ed8fd1bff743f024db9f7abc97d7c942a6ec00f639f
spent
true